Abstract:
There is provided an RFID tag having multi-voltage multipliers including two or more antennas configured to receive electromagnetic waves emitted from a reader, a first voltage multiplier configured to be connected to one of the antennas and change the received AC electromagnetic waves to DC voltage signals, a modulator configured to transmit backscattering communication signals by changing impedance through the antenna connected to the first voltage multiplier, and a second voltage multiplier configured to be connected to another antenna among the antennas and change AC electromagnetic waves received from the other antenna to DC voltage signals.
Abstract:
In relation to a security function of a radio frequency identification (RFID) tag, an RFID tag and a method of updating a key of the RFID tag that may manage a key to be used for an access to a reader by storing the key in a memory having a duplex structure, thereby minimizing an update error occurring during a process of updating the key are provided.
